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Leeds, England and Dungarvan, IE-WD, Ireland?

There is no direct connection from Leeds to Dungarvan. However, you can take the train to Manchester Airport, walk to Manchester Airport (MAN) airport, fly to Cork Airport (ORK), walk to Cork Airport, take the line 225 bus to Cork Bus Station, then take the bus to Dungarvan. Alternatively, you can take a train from Leeds to Dungarvan via Chester, Holyhead, Holyhead Ferry, Dublin Ferryport B+I, The Point, Red Cow, and Red Cow Luas in around 13h 35m.
